On 02/21/2016 01:25 PM, Jayesh Badwaik wrote:
> Similar errors have occurred when archlinux-keyring package is not up to date 
> with other packages. 
> 
> $ pacman-key --refresh-keys 
> 
> should resolve this if it is the same issue. 

Yep, I stumbled around, added mksh to 'IgnorePkg   =' in pacman.conf updated
(keyring updated), removed the 'IgnorePkg', then mksh installed just fine.

 $ pacman-key --refresh-keys  (would have been a lot easier :)
